Additionally, adoptive parents must undergo a home study.Here’s a sampling of average adoption costs: Private domestic adoption with an agency: $41,532. Private domestic adoption with an attorney: $34,594. Foster care adoption: $2,811. International adoption (varies by country): $36,070 to $46,412. Adopting an American infant rather than an older child is more expensive, with the total cost fees for this type of adoption averaging about $40,000-$45,000, although in some cases the costs may be higher. International adoptions tend to be the most expensive option, with expenses ranging from $25,000 – $50,000 or more from start to …The average cost to adopt a child is $30,000 to $60,000 if adopting through a private agency in the U.S. International adoption costs $25,000 to $50,000, depending on the country you're adopting from. The most affordable way to adopt is through the foster care system, with costs often totaling less than $1,000. Foster care adoption typically costs $0 to $5,000 in nominal fees and home studies. International adoption or adoption through a private agency, on the other hand, might cost $30,000 to $60,000 or more.Counseling services for the Birth Parent or child for reasonable time before and after the adoption placement. Legal expenses, agency fees, and cost of travel related to the adoption. Costs of the pre and postplacement assessments. If you’re ready to adopt, you may be wondering...Adoptive Families Magazine found the following about foster care adoption: Average Costs of Foster Care Adoption. Home study fee: $231. Attorney fees: $1,573. Travel expenses: $342. All other expenses: $598.
